Responsibilities

The HR Assistant will undertake functions as mentioned below:

  • Ensures implementation of HR processes as per I’m Possible rules, regulations, policies and strategies;
  • Assist in the recruitment process including developing job descriptions, preparing job adverts, checking application forms, shortlisting, interviewing and preparing contracts;
  • Identify legal requirements and government reporting regulations affecting human resources functions and ensuring policies, procedures, and reporting are in compliance
  • Do the calculation and payment of NSSF (social security) and income taxes via Ministry of Finance (monthly and yearly) as well as all other annual declarations to Ministry of Finance
  • Ensure a properly working filing system of personnel files with respect to relevant documents, contracts, and payment files, performance reviews, and terminations, and promotions.
  • Administer payroll and maintain employee records ensuring personnel files are updated and reviewed every 3 months, timely collection of personnel timesheets, supporting in the processing of wages on a monthly basis and maintaining records of absence and leaves.
  • Support and manage the performance appraisal review.
  • Plan and deliver training, including new staff inductions.
  • Ensure the confidentiality of information dealt with the course of the administration work.
